Rocket issues delay 1st-ever private mission to Venus: 'We are awaiting Neutron readiness'

The future of a privately backed robotic mission Venus seems about as cloudy as the planet itself at the moment.

Scientists based at the Massachusetts Institute of Technology (MIT) are working with the California-based company Rocket Lab to search for possible signs of life on Venus.

The first step in that program is the Rocket Lab Mission to Venus , which will deploy a small, nose cone-like probe crafted to sample the Venusian atmosphere using a device called an autofluorescence nephelometer (AFN).

That AFN can measure individual particles in Venusian clouds , constraining their size, shape and composition in a search for signs of organic molecules.But that undertaking, primarily fueled by private dollars, has been waylaid due to getting a needed booster flight-qualified.

Neutron readiness "We call ourselves the Morning Star Missions to Venus.

The Rocket Lab Mission is the first mission in the series," said Sara Seager, a noted professor of planetary science at MIT.

"Rocket Lab moved the project to the Neutron rocket , and we are awaiting Neutron readiness," Seager told Space.com.

Neutron was originally expected to debut in 2024 , but it has yet to make its maiden voyage.

That first flight, which will launch from Rocket Lab's Launch Complex 3 on Wallops Island, Virginia, also depends on the successful completion of the vehicle's qualification testing and acceptance program, according to the company.

While Venus probing via private means has been a bit booster-bushwhacked, there has been promising progress with the venture.

An illustration shows Rocket Lab's Photon spacecraft above the clouds of Venus (Image credit: Rocket Lab) Ready for Venus duty Rocket Lab is providing the shell for the entry probe.

NASA's Ames Research Center developed its heat shield, called the Heatshield for Extreme Entry Environment Technology (HEEET), which consists of woven material that can protect the spacecraft against temperatures up to 4,500 degrees Fahrenheit (2,500 degrees Celsius).

Also ready for Venus duty is the probe's pressure vessel.

Seager's team is providing the AFN, along with their ongoing, rigorous science preparation.
